Murder detectives have made two arrests after a man was stabbed "several times" on a residential street in Cheshire. The victim has now been named as Lloyd Velasquez, aged 34.
At around 8.20pm yesterday police were called to reports that a man had been assaulted on Summertrees Road, Ellesmere Port. Officers attended the scene, and Mr Velasquez was treated by paramedics at the scene before being taken to the Countess of Chester Hospital.
Sadly, despite the best efforts of all those involved, he has since died. Mr Velasquez is from Ellesmere Port. His family have been informed and are being supported by specialist officers at this time.
Cheshire Constabulary said in a statement: "Enquiries in relation to the incident have been ongoing throughout the night, and it is now believed that the victim was assaulted by three men who were known to him. "Two men have since been arrested in relation to the incident, a 19-year-old man and a 21-year-old man, both from Ellesmere Port.
